Meaning & Origin
A person who travels on a vehicle or a mount. This name suggests a sense of adventure, exploration, and the ability to overcome obstacles.

Cultural & Spiritual notes
The name "Rider" holds a significant cultural impact as it is associated with the concept of travel and exploration in Hindu mythology. Hindu mythology emphasizes the importance of journeying and seeking knowledge and experiences. Gods and goddesses, as well as legendary heroes and sages are frequently depicted as undertaking spiritual journeys or symbolic voyages to gain knowledge, power, and inner peace. The "Rider" name can be seen as a reflection of this cultural value of adventure, exploration, and seeking new experiences.
From a spiritual perspective, the name "Rider" can be seen as a symbol of the eternal journey of the soul. According to Hindu belief, the soul is on a continuous journey from birth to death and beyond. The name "Rider" suggests a sense of being in control of one's own spiritual journey and being able to navigate the challenges and obstacles that come along the way. Additionally, the name can be seen as a reminder to keep moving forward on the spiritual path, even when faced with difficulties and setbacks. Overall, the name "Rider" carries a powerful spiritual message of adventure, perseverance, and the importance of continually seeking inner growth and wisdom.
